Ralf Sieckmann is German and European Patent and Trade Marks Attorney, now Patentanwalt i.R.. He has studied Chemistry and Economics and Law. Ralf obtained his diploma (M.Sc.) and his doctoral thesis (Ph.D) at Ruhr-University Bochum, passed German Patent Attorneys Examination, the European Qualifying Examination and entered into EUIPO list. Ralf was admitted as patent attorney in 1990, in 1994 till the end of 2021 joined Cohausz Hannig Borkowski Wißgott, Duesseldorf and since 2022 to the end of 2023 works as a Patent Attorney in Ratingen.
He’s working for more than 30 years in industrial property rights protection, specialized in patent and trade mark law; management consultancy in IP (patent and trade mark strategies). Specialities: trade marks including new media, chemistry, pharmacy, chemical engineering and related non mechanical fields. Ralf was lecturer on industrial property at Duesseldorf University for Applied Sciences, School of Arts from 1997 to 2001, and at School of Electrical Engineering from 2009 to 2012 teaching IP (patents, trade mark, design) to under-graduate students and regularly speaks on trade mark and patents topics. He was Referee @ North Rhine-Westphalia regional competition instance of Youth Researchers (Jugend forscht) between 2004 and 2017.
He is Co-author of BUSINESS ANGELS (2002), Lesson on Trade Mark Law in IN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Y (2006 - 2012), Sound Trade and Service Marks – Legal aspects in AUDIO BRANDING (2009), technical coordinator of INTERNATIONALES MARKENRECHT (2007, 2008), Co-author of Lessons on Madrid Agreement and Protocol, Community Trade Marks after Publication.
Ralf provides information on non-traditional trademarks worldwide since 2003 after Landmark Judgment of 12 December 2002 in Case C-273/00, (Ralf Sieckmann vs DPMA) on graphic representability of national trade marks and EUTM. This archive has the function to inform and help IP professionals and students in the field of law and economics writing their thesis on this subject matter. It includes comments, books and case law on the said decision and an annual compilation of the said Non-Traditional Trademarks published at the beginning of every year.
